The Power of Themed Cohesion
The biggest mistake in basket building is mixing unrelated items. A great basket tells a story. Consider these highly effective themes:
- The Gourmet Brunch Basket: Think high-end coffee, artisanal jams, miniature quiches, and fancy napkins. The Relaxation Retreat Basket: Must include luxurious bath bombs, scented candles, soft socks, and maybe a plush reading blanket. The Hobbyist Basket: Tailor this to her specific interests—gardening tools, watercolor sets, or gourmet baking mixes.

Budgeting for Delight, Not Deficiency
A common pitfall is thinking that expensive equals perfect. A thoughtful, high-quality basket built on a moderate budget can far outperform an over-the-top, poorly curated, expensive one. Instead of spending hundreds of dollars on a single, grand item, consider assembling several smaller, high-quality components. This allows you to spread the budget across more enjoyable sensory experiences.
